keywords: genome sequence, 16S sequence, Bacteria, anaerobe, spore-forming, mesophilic, Gram-positive, human pathogen
description: Clostridium perfringens ES-MS 22 is an anaerobe, spore-forming, mesophilic human pathogen that was isolated from spacecraft-associated clean room class ISO 8, Herschel Space Observatory.
